Suspected Kidnapper Slumps, Dies While Trying To Escape Arrest

A suspected kidnapper who was part of a syndicate that abducted a 23-year-old student of the Bauchi State University, slumped and died while trying to escape arrest at a military checkpoint.

The deceased and two others who kidnapped the student were said to have also snatched a Toyota Camry 2010 model which they used in taking their victim away.

However, they ran out of luck when they got to a military checkpoint mounted by operatives of the 133 Special Forces Battalion Battalion based in Azare, Katagum Local Government Area of Bauchi state, where they were promptly arrested.

Meanwhile, the deceased immediately escaped at the scene of the arrest but suddenly slumped and was rushed to the Federal Medical Center, Azare where he was certified dead by a medical doctor.

The Police Public Relations Officer, Bauchi State Command, Ahmed Wakil, disclosed these in a media statement he made available to journalists in the state on Tuesday.

Wakil, a Superintendent of Police, said that two other suspects were handed over to the Command by troops of the Special Forces Battalion.

He said: “Based on inter-agency collaboration towards complementing the constitutional mandates of the Police as a lead Agency in maintaining the internal security, six suspects were handed over to the Command by operatives of 133 Special Forces Battalion based in Azare, Bauchi state.

“Preliminary investigation uncovered that the suspects kidnapped a 23-year old student of Bauchi State University, Gadau, residing at Federal Low Cost of Azare town, Bauchi state and whisked away the victim along with a snatched Toyota Camry 2010 with Reg No. (Withheld), took their victim swiftly headed to the Misau town route.

“Upon receiving the distress call, the military stationed at the checkpoint responded immediately and intercepted the stolen vehicle alongside the suspects.

“Meanwhile, the victim was rescued unhurt.

“However, one of the suspects Damilola James, male, of Turum area of Bauchi slumped while trying to escape before reaching the checkpoint and was taken to Federal Medical Center (FMC) Azare for immediate medical attention but certified dead by a medical doctor.”

He said that exhibits found in the suspects’ possession are: Eight different mobile phones, knives and assorted charms (Juju).

According to him, during further Investigation, all the suspects confessed to the crime, adding that a discreet investigation has commenced after which the suspects would be charged to court for prosecution.

Similarly, the PPRO said that operatives attached to the Command have arrested Suleiman Samaila, male (32), a student of Bauchi State University, Itas Gadau Campus for causing grievous hurt to a fellow student.

He said that a report available to the Command revealed that on June 10, 2023, at about 5.15 pm, a misunderstanding ensued among the students of Bauchi State University, Itas Gadau campus during a friendly football match at the off-campus football pitch.

“In the event, one Safiyanu Adam Musa, male (23), a 200-level bio-chemistry student of the same institution was attacked by the said Suleiman Samaila. As a result, the victim sustained a serious injury on his left hand.

“Upon receipt of the report, a team of policemen visited the scene and conveyed the victim to the Federal Medical Centre, Azare for medical attention. The victim is recuperating from the deep cut sustained during the incident,” he said.

Wakil said that the arrested suspect has confessed to his crime and would be charged in court for the established offences upon completion of the discreet investigation.
